- Kathleen Gibbs Weisenburger - February 12, 1907 - November 11, 1974. Daughter of George and Katherine Donovan Gibbs. Wife of Emil Fredrick Weisenburger.
Newspaper Obituary - Tuesday, November 12, 1974 Palladium Times - Oswego, New York - Lacona - Mrs. Kathleen Weisenburger, 67, former clerk of the Town of Sandy Creek, died unexpectedly Monday evening at her home here. She was the widow of Emil Weisenburger. Mrs. Weisenburger was born February 12, 1907, in Centerville, daughter of George and Katherine Donovan Gibbs. She attended local schools, was graduated from the Former Oswego Normal School, and taught in Daysville, Sandy Creek, and Belleville schools. A lifelong resident of this area, Mrs. Weisenburger had spent 44 years at her present [line unreadable] husband operated a garage and appliance sales and service business. She was a member of the Senior Citizens and directed the Meals on Wheels project through the United Methodist church here. Surviving are two daughters, Mrs. Paul (Joyce) Guyette, Lacona, and Mrs. Robert (Karen) Bacon of Clay; eight grandchildren; two great-grandchildren, and one brother, George Gibbs, Constantia. Funeral arrangements are incomplete, but calling hours will be at the Summerville Funeral Home, Sandy Creek, Thursday from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m. with burial in South Richland cemetery.
